Quickline vs. TeleKing – Monthly price comparison

The Quickline 1 Gbit/s plan costs an effective CHF 47.29/month (all fees included over the contract term). The TeleKing 1 Gbit/s plan comes to CHF 43.30/month – TeleKing is therefore CHF 3.99 per month cheaper than Quickline. Note for Quickline: Promopreis für 24 Monate Note for TeleKing: 50% discount until end of December 2026 (promo for orders placed by end of June 2026), then CHF 48/month.

The offers in detail

Quickline: The Quickline 1 Gbit plan offers a download and upload speed of 1000 Mbit/s at a price of CHF 39 per month. Please note that this is a promotional offer, and the price will increase to CHF 69 after 24 months. A WLAN router is included in the price, and the minimum contract duration is 24 months. TeleKing: The TeleKing 1 Gbit plan offers a download and upload speed of 1000 Mbit/s for CHF 24 per month. Please note that the price increases to CHF 48 after 7 months and there is a minimum contract duration of 20 months. A WLAN router is included in the price.

Total cost over the contract term

Quickline offers a term of 24 months (total cost: CHF 1'135.00). TeleKing commits for 20 months (total cost: CHF 866.00). Note: the Quickline price starts at CHF 44.00/month and increases after 24 months to CHF 69.00/month. Note: the TeleKing price starts at CHF 24.00/month and increases after 6 months to CHF 48.00/month.

Cost comparison over 24 months

Projected to a common 24-month basis, Quickline costs a total of CHF 1'135.00, TeleKing comes to CHF 1'058.00 – TeleKing is CHF 77.00 cheaper over this period.

Internet speed comparison

Both plans deliver up to 1000 Mbit/s download and 1000 Mbit/s upload. Quickline uses Kabel and fiber, TeleKing uses fiber.

Contract terms and minimum duration

Quickline commits for 24 months (notice: 3 months). TeleKing commits for 20 months (notice: 1 month).

Router and setup fees

With Quickline: Wi-Fi router included, activation fee CHF 79.00. With TeleKing: Wi-Fi router included, activation fee CHF 50.00.

Customer satisfaction: Quickline vs. TeleKing

In the Zufriedenmit.ch score, Quickline achieves 35/100 points, TeleKing scores 82 points (TeleKing leads); on Google, Quickline is rated 3.6/5 stars (331 reviews), TeleKing 4.8/5 (185 reviews); on Trustpilot, Quickline scores 1.7/5 (198), TeleKing 4.1/5 (40).

Verdict: Who comes out ahead in the direct comparison?

TeleKing stands out on price (CHF 43.30/month), flexibility (20 months min. term), customer ratings and Zufriedenmit.ch score. For those focused on price, TeleKing is the better choice.
